Dominant Factors of Ionic Transport in Lithium Ionics Materials with A Three-Dimensional Oxide Framework Jun Kuwano (Tokyo Univ. of Science) OME2014-71 |

Over 50 series of Li-ion conducting A-site deficient perovskite solid solutions (Li-ADPESSs) were synthesized, and their ionic conductivities were measured. Multiple regression analysis was performed on the observed ionic conductivities with a function of the explanatory variables of the flexibility (FF) of the condensed oxyacid framework determined from the BO4 stretch mode, the bottleneck size (BS), the tolerance factor, and the four variances of the ionic radii and charge numbers of the A- and B-site ions, and the resultant correlation coefficient R was as good as 0.91. The important knowledge obtained from the regression analysis was as follows: 1) Demonstration of the FF - BS theory: the optimal BS depends on the flexibility (i.e., If flexible, the optimal BS is small, and if rigid, large) 2) The explanatory variables are regarded as the dominant factors for the conductivity. This is the first success to determine the dominant factors by multiple regression analysis, and the BS-FF theory will be very useful for development of solid state ionics materials. |
